Halloween Costume dance competition?!


Question Posted Saturday August 27 2011, 1:59 am

So my best mate and I are going to be competing in a dance costume contest for this up coming Halloween. We're going to be dressing as Jake and Natiri from the Avatar movie. We've got our costumes pretty much down, but see we're going to be dancing and we would like to be in character as much as possible. Avatars are barefoot and seeing as to how we're going to be dancing on concrete, we need ideas on foot support. A friend of ours suggested duck taping or somehow sticking Dr.Sholl's soles on the bottom of our feet. I'm looking for another alternative, as to they might fall off while dancing.
Looking forward to suggestions and any help provided. Good day to you! (:

xokristabelle answered Saturday August 27 2011, 10:41 pm:
They make special dance shoes called half-soles that you could wear- they cover the bottoms of your feet but don't show. These are what they look like from the top : [Link](Mouse over link to see full location) Check your local dance store, most places carry them.

LM answered Saturday August 27 2011, 6:46 pm:
A few suggestions.
- Blue flats (or whatever color Avatars are on their feet.. haha)
"Set up" your dance area with something brown or green (earth toned) that is squishy, like a yoga mat or rug.


Also, depending on how long you're dancing and what sort of dancing you are doing, the concrete might not be too painful. If it's an all-night thing, you could get some flip-flops in the right color from Old Navy (they have basically every color and they're cheap). You could slip in and out of them as needed.
